摘要: 糖尿病视网膜病变(diabetic retinopathy, DR)是糖尿病患者常见的严重并发症,严重影响视力甚至导致失明,然而其发病机制尚未彻底阐明。近年研究发现细胞焦亡作为一种新型的程序性细胞死亡形式,在DR的发病机制中发挥着关键作用。细胞焦亡在DR发病机制中的分子通路,涵盖炎性反应、氧化应激以及细胞信号传导等多个层面,涉及多个关键途径,如线粒体功能障碍、ROS积累和Fas/FasL信号轴,这些途径导致视网膜细胞退化。治疗策略侧重于针对细胞焦亡调节剂,包括caspase抑制剂、线粒体稳定剂和Bcl-2家族蛋白,以防止视网膜细胞死亡。此外,调节氧化应激、炎性反应和自噬是潜在的治疗途径,开发专门调节这些途径的靶向疗法,以及基因疗法和小分子抑制剂,可以提供预防糖尿病视网膜病变进展的有希望的疗法。(国际眼科纵览,2025, 49:45-50)

Abstract: Diabetic retinopathy (DR) is a common and serious complication in people with diabetes, severely affecting vision and even leading to blindness. However, the pathogenesis of DR has not been thoroughly elucidated. Recent studies have found that pyroptosis, as a novel form of programmed cell death, has played a key role in the pathogenesis of DR. The molecular pathways of pyroptosis in the pathogenesis of DR, covering multiple levels such as inflammatory response, oxidative stress, and cell signaling, and identify multiple key pathways, such as mitochondrial dysfunction, ROS accumulation, and Fas/FasL signaling axis, which lead to retinal cell degeneration. Therapeutic strategies focus on targeting pyrotosis modulators, including caspase inhibitors, mitochondrial stabilizers, and Bcl-2 family proteins, to prevent retinal cell death. Additionally,moduating oxidative stress, inflammatory response, and autophagy are potential therapeutic approaches, The developing targeted therapies that specifically modulate these pathways, as well as gene therapies and small molecule inhibitors, could provide promising therapies to prevent the progression of diabetic retinopathy.
